December 23 (SeeNews) - Following is a schedule of corporate, economic and political events taking place in or related to Bulgaria through April 14. New or amended entries are marked (*).
* Wednesday, December 23 – Sofia: Bulgaria’s Finance Ministry, the Regional Development Ministry and the Bulgarian Construction Chamber will sign an agreement settling the debt the Bulgarian government owes to construction companies in the country.
Wednesday, December 23 – Sofia: Central bank to release October money supply data. (1000 GMT)
Wednesday, December 23 – Sofia: Central bank to release end-October gross foreign debt figures. (1200 GMT)
